The Revolutionary Technology Of Metal AM

Metal additive manufacturing, or metal AM, has been making waves in the manufacturing industry in recent years This innovative technology allows for the creation of complex metal parts with unprecedented precision and efficiency From aerospace to automotive, metal AM is changing the way products are designed, prototyped, and produced In this article, we will delve into the world of metal AM and explore the various applications and benefits of this groundbreaking technology.

Metal AM, also known as metal 3D printing, is a process that involves building metal parts layer by layer using a computer-controlled laser or electron beam This additive manufacturing technique allows for the creation of intricate and precise parts that would be impossible to produce using traditional manufacturing methods By building up the part layer by layer, metal AM enables designers to create complex geometries and internal structures that are not achievable with traditional machining or casting processes.

One of the key advantages of metal AM is the ability to produce highly customized and complex parts with minimal waste Traditional manufacturing methods often result in a significant amount of material being wasted during the machining or casting process With metal AM, only the material that is needed to create the part is used, resulting in less waste and greater efficiency This makes metal AM an environmentally friendly manufacturing process that is increasingly being adopted by industries looking to reduce their carbon footprint.

Another major advantage of metal AM is the ability to produce parts with superior mechanical properties The layer-by-layer construction of metal parts allows for precise control over the material properties, resulting in parts that are stronger, lighter, and more durable than those produced using traditional manufacturing methods This makes metal AM ideal for applications where high strength-to-weight ratios are critical, such as in aerospace and automotive industries.

Metal AM is also revolutionizing the way products are prototyped and manufactured metal am. Traditional manufacturing processes often require expensive tooling and long lead times to produce prototypes and test new designs Metal AM allows for rapid prototyping and iteration of designs, enabling manufacturers to quickly and cost-effectively test new ideas and concepts This accelerated product development cycle brings products to market faster and more efficiently, giving companies a competitive edge in today’s fast-paced business environment.

The applications of metal AM are vast and varied, ranging from aerospace and automotive to healthcare and consumer goods In the aerospace industry, metal AM is used to produce complex components for aircraft engines and structures, reducing weight and improving fuel efficiency In the automotive industry, metal AM is used to create lightweight parts for electric vehicles, improving range and performance In the healthcare industry, metal AM is used to produce customized medical implants and prosthetics, improving patient outcomes and quality of life.

Preserving The Beauty: The Importance Of Art Conservation And Restoration

art conservation and restoration play a crucial role in preserving and protecting the world’s cultural heritage for future generations. The process of art conservation involves the careful examination, cleaning, repair, and preservation of artworks to maintain their original beauty and integrity. This meticulous practice ensures that art pieces are safeguarded against deterioration, damage, and the effects of aging over time.

art conservation and restoration are not only important for maintaining the aesthetic qualities of artworks but also for preserving their historical, cultural, and artistic significance. Through conservation efforts, art historians and researchers can learn more about the materials, techniques, and styles used by artists in different periods of history. By studying and analyzing artworks, conservators can unravel the mysteries behind their creation and gain valuable insights into the artistic practices of the past.

One of the main goals of art conservation is to prevent further deterioration and damage to artworks. Factors such as exposure to light, temperature fluctuations, humidity, air pollution, and improper handling can all contribute to the decay of artworks. Conservation specialists use a variety of techniques and materials to protect artworks from these harmful factors and ensure their long-term preservation. Professional conservators are trained to assess the condition of artworks, identify any existing problems, and develop custom-tailored treatment plans to address specific conservation needs.

Restoration, on the other hand, is the process of repairing and reconstructing artworks that have been damaged or altered over time. This may involve repairing tears, filling in missing areas, retouching areas of loss, or removing old varnishes and coatings that have yellowed or discolored over time. The goal of restoration is to bring artworks back to their original appearance while respecting their historical and artistic integrity. Restorers work closely with conservators to ensure that any interventions are reversible, minimally invasive, and in line with professional ethics and standards.

art conservation and restoration require a high level of expertise, specialized knowledge, and technical skills. Conservators and restorers undergo rigorous training and education to develop proficiency in a range of disciplines, including art history, chemistry, materials science, and conservation techniques. They must also stay up-to-date with the latest research, technologies, and best practices in the field to carry out their work effectively and ethically.

Understanding The Process Of Spark Erosion

spark erosion, also known as electrical discharge machining (EDM), is a manufacturing process that involves removing material from a workpiece using electrical discharges. This highly precise and efficient method is commonly used in industries such as aerospace, automotive, and healthcare to create intricate shapes and patterns that would be difficult or impossible to achieve through traditional machining methods. In this article, we will explore the basics of spark erosion and how it works.

The principle behind spark erosion is fairly straightforward. A workpiece, typically made of conducting material such as metal, is submerged in a dielectric fluid bath. A tool electrode, also made of conducting material, is brought close to the workpiece. An electrical voltage is applied between the tool electrode and the workpiece, creating a potential difference. When the voltage reaches a certain threshold, electrical discharges occur between the tool electrode and the workpiece, leading to the removal of small particles of material from the workpiece.

The process of spark erosion is highly controlled and precise. The discharges create a series of small craters on the surface of the workpiece, gradually eroding away material in a controlled manner. By controlling the intensity and frequency of the electrical discharges, operators can precisely shape the workpiece according to the desired specifications. This level of precision makes spark erosion ideal for creating complex geometries, tight tolerances, and fine surface finishes.

One of the key advantages of spark erosion is its ability to machine extremely hard materials. Traditional machining methods such as milling or turning can struggle to work with materials like hardened steels, titanium, or carbide. In contrast, spark erosion can easily cut through these tough materials with high accuracy and minimal tool wear. This makes spark erosion a versatile and cost-effective solution for industries that work with challenging materials.

Another benefit of spark erosion is its ability to create intricate and delicate features on a workpiece. The highly controlled nature of the process allows for the machining of fine details, sharp corners, and complex shapes that would be difficult to achieve with traditional machining methods. This makes spark erosion a popular choice for industries that require high precision and intricate designs, such as the production of molds, dies, and medical devices.

Despite its many advantages, spark erosion does have some limitations. The process is relatively slow compared to traditional machining methods, which can make it less suitable for high-volume production runs. Additionally, the cost of equipment and maintenance for spark erosion machines can be higher than for traditional machining tools. However, for applications that require high precision, tight tolerances, and complex geometries, the benefits of spark erosion often outweigh these drawbacks.
